Address 0 DOGE

DRRttJ7RsNFD6PpL4HxV1xiK351fnAf5KL

Confirmed

Total Received 1812.63868093 DOGE
Total Sent 1812.63868093 DOGE
Final Balance 0 DOGE
No. Transactions 2

Transactions